Env vars for the Wayfinder address autocomplete widget (Cartlane project). Set the region endpoint and debounce interval per environment; staging uses the sandbox geocoder. Rate limits are enforced server-side, so don't retry aggressively. The widget won't initialize without its geocoder credential, which the env file must define — that entry belongs immediately after this sentence.

sealed setting: ARCHIVE_KEY3=8d0

Q: Where is the first-aid room and how do visitors access it?
A: Ground floor, Haldren Wing, beside the print room. Door is kept locked. Escort visitors there yourself — do not send them alone. Log every use in the blue folder on the shelf inside. Defibrillator is on the wall outside. The keypad code is below.

door code, yagap-bahof: bdg-O-05

## Signing the Crumbline Cutoff Build

Welcome! Crumbline enforces the 2pm bakery order cutoff in the Doughmate app, so every release of the cutoff module gets signed before it ships. No signature, no deploy — the ovens wait for nobody. Sign using the team key from the vault, shown here for reference.

deploy key for kajof-fajop: bky6_gDHw9Q

## Font Vendoring Limits

Vendored font bundles in the Larkspool build are subject to strict size and count quotas, enforced at release time. Exceeding any quota blocks the release pipeline; waivers require a recorded exception. Please verify each bundle against the current thresholds, which are defined below.

tuning table, yajog-yahof:
BUDGETS = {
    "lamvan": 303,
    "wenox": 460,
    "fenvan": 525,
}

# Bloom filter settings for the Marrowvale key-value tier.
# The filter sits in front of the Tindercache store and rejects
# lookups for keys that were never written, cutting backend load
# by roughly 60%. False positives are expected and harmless; a
# miss simply falls through to the store. Resize only via the
# reindex job, never by hand. The filter's seed table lives in
# the metadata database, reachable with the connection string below.

primary connection of tajeg-tajop = postgresql://julax_svc:DI@db-e7f3.kelvidyn.corp:5432/rusdor